Should TSCTA cancel or reschedule a class due to weather or unforeseen circumstances beyond the control of TSCTA, the client is entitled to a full refund however TSCTA is not responsible for travel arrangements, travel fees, or any expenses incurred by you as a result of such cancellation. It is the responsibility of CH to contact the student to reschedule and/or process the refund. If a course is cancelled at the request of TSCTA, after the student has registered, TSCTA will notify CH of the change and advise that the client is eligible to be rescheduled to another event or entitled to a full refund. TSCTA reserves the right to cancel or reschedule classes at any time. Original cancellation policy (non-COVID-19): We are waiving the penalty for cancellation or postponement requests that are not provided within the appropriate time period (3-days prior to the start of training). Note: This provider has a temporary cancellation policy for COVID-19 related cancellations which is as follows: Should students miss any portion of the training, it is the student’s responsibility to contact TSCTA to arrange to attend another scheduled event. Make-up time is not permitted for this training course. Students must contact TSCTA to schedule and pay for the retake class within 6 months following the original class date. Students who do not pass the written or practical exam will have one opportunity to retake the entire 32-hour course and retake the exam at reduced fee of $200. Students must obtain a score of 70% or higher to receive the course completion ID card. Students are required to complete 100% of the course and actively participate in all learning activities including hands-on demonstrations and the final course exam.
